Ghana Electrical Contractors Association (GECA), founded in 1948, is a member-based association of Electrical Contractors in Ghana. GECA is Ghana’s leading trade association representing the interests of contractors who design, install, inspect, test and maintain electrical and electronic equipment and services.   Its mission is to provide a focal point for all licensed electrical contractors in Ghana, to plan for the welfare of members and promote electrical contracting works throughout the country.

In seeking to secure and maintain a high-level of professional standards among members, the association also aims at regulating the conduct of members of the association generally.   GECA has over 1000 members across the ten regions of Ghana. GECA is composed of a National Association governed by an elected Council comprised of a National President, its executive officers, ten Regional Chairmen and their executive members.
